Economize até $20.000 em Confluent
Confluent
12 meses grátis
110.000+ empresas economizaram mais de $100m em 460+ softwares de primeira linha.
Economize até $20.000 em Confluent
Confluent
12 meses grátis
Escolher a plataforma de dados certa é crucial para aproveitar todo o potencial dos seus dados para gerar insights e tomar decisões informadas. Essas plataformas facilitam integração de dados em tempo real e análises avançadas, fortalecendo sua capacidade de agir rapidamente com base em insights orientados por dados. Além disso, elas suportam diversas capacidades de manipulação de dados, desde streaming de dados até armazenamento de dados em larga escala, melhorando a eficiência e escalabilidade da sua arquitetura de dados.
Várias soluções estão disponíveis para gerenciar e analisar seus dados—como você escolhe a melhor para suas necessidades? Neste artigo, ajudamos você fornecendo uma comparação detalhada de duas plataformas de dados líderes, Confluent e Snowflake. Ao examinar suas principais características e diferenças-chave, você terá uma compreensão mais clara de qual plataforma se alinha melhor à sua estratégia de dados e objetivos de negócios, ajudando você a fazer uma escolha mais informada.
Confluent e Snowflake são duas figuras influentes no setor de gestão e análise de dados, cada uma trazendo forças distintas adaptadas para atender a requisitos organizacionais específicos.
Confluent é principalmente celebrada por suas capacidades de streaming de dados em tempo real, aproveitando o Apache Kafka para permitir o processamento e integração contínuos de dados em vários sistemas. Esta plataforma é ideal para organizações que precisam gerenciar grandes volumes de dados recebidos em tempo real, facilitando a tomada de decisões imediatas baseadas em dados. Por outro lado, Snowflake se destaca em armazenamento de dados e data warehousing em larga escala, fornecendo soluções robustas para consolidação, análise e compartilhamento seguro de dados em ambientes de nuvem.
Para fazer uma escolha informada entre Confluent e Snowflake, é essencial considerar suas necessidades específicas de dados, a escala organizacional e a sofisticação técnica de suas equipes.
Confluent e Snowflake são soluções proeminentes de gerenciamento de dados com focos distintos, projetadas para atender a diferentes aspectos do manuseio e análise de dados. Ao considerar qual plataforma é a melhor para as necessidades do seu negócio, é importante entender as principais diferenças entre elas.
Confluent é construída em torno de Apache Kafka e se destaca em capacidades de streaming de dados em tempo real. Ela permite que as organizações processem e analisem dados à medida que chegam, o que é crucial para cenários em que a utilização imediata dos dados pode gerar valor significativo para os negócios. A plataforma da Confluent facilita a ingestão contínua de dados, processamento e redistribuição através dos sistemas da empresa, tornando-se uma ferramenta poderosa para negócios que dependem de dados oportunos para a tomada de decisões operacionais. Isso torna a Confluent particularmente adequada para indústrias como serviços financeiros, telecomunicações e serviços online, onde o processamento de streams de dados em tempo real é essencial.
Em contraste, Snowflake foca em armazenamento de dados em nuvem e soluções de armazenamento de dados em larga escala. Ela fornece uma plataforma centralizada para armazenar e analisar grandes quantidades de dados estruturados e semi-estruturados, sem as complexidades operacionais tradicionalmente associadas aos data warehouses. A arquitetura do Snowflake permite escalar computação e armazenamento de forma independente, tornando-a altamente eficiente para gerenciar cargas de trabalho flutuantes e análise de dados em larga escala. Isso a torna ideal para empresas que precisam realizar consultas e análises complexas em grandes conjuntos de dados, como nas indústrias de varejo, saúde e mídia.
Outra grande diferença reside em sua abordagem à escalabilidade e gerenciamento de dados. Confluent aproveita um sistema distribuído que pode lidar com pipelines de dados de alta vazão, adequado para arquiteturas orientadas a eventos. Snowflake, no entanto, utiliza uma arquitetura de dados compartilhados em múltiplos clusters que permite acesso e consulta simultâneos de dados por muitos usuários, sem impactar o desempenho.
Se as necessidades do seu negócio envolvem streaming de dados em tempo real e capacidade de resposta imediata, a Confluent é provavelmente a escolha mais apropriada. Se o seu foco está mais em capacidades robustas de armazenamento de dados com análise e armazenamento de dados em larga escala flexíveis, então o Snowflake seria mais adequado.
Confluent e Snowflake atendem a aspectos distintos, mas complementares, da gestão de dados. Confluent, centrado no Apache Kafka, se destaca em streaming de dados em tempo real e arquitetura orientada a eventos, oferecendo escalabilidade e integração com o ecossistema. Sua complexidade e sobrecarga operacional podem desestimular alguns usuários.
Por outro lado, Snowflake, uma plataforma de armazenamento de dados em nuvem, enfatiza escalabilidade, desempenho e facilidade de uso. É totalmente gerenciado e otimizado para consultas baseadas em SQL, mas os usuários podem enfrentar custos por alta concorrência e saída de dados. A escolha entre Confluent e Snowflake depende das necessidades da organização: processamento e streaming de dados em tempo real com Confluent, ou análises e consultas estruturadas com Snowflake.
Enquanto Confluent e Snowflake desempenham papéis vitais na gestão de dados, eles atendem a necessidades fundamentalmente diferentes dentro do ciclo de vida dos dados. Confluent é particularmente vantajoso para empresas que requerem capacidade robusta de streaming de dados em tempo real. Ele permite que as organizações processem e movimentem grandes volumes de dados de forma eficiente com latência mínima, o que é crucial para aplicações que dependem de atualizações de dados em tempo hábil.
Por outro lado, Snowflake é ideal para entidades que precisam de uma solução poderosa de armazenamento de dados que simplifica o armazenamento, acesso e análise de dados, particularmente para análise de dados históricos onde consultas SQL complexas são comuns.
Confluent é mais usado para streaming de dados em tempo real e arquitetura orientada a eventos. Ele se destaca em cenários onde as organizações precisam processar e analisar dados à medida que chegam, possibilitando insights e ações oportunas. A plataforma da Confluent, construída em torno do Apache Kafka, oferece alta escalabilidade, confiabilidade e integração com o ecossistema, tornando-a adequada para uma ampla gama de casos de uso, como análises em tempo real, monitoramento e integração de dados.
Indústrias como finanças, varejo e telecomunicações utilizam a Confluent para impulsionar aplicações como detecção de fraudes, gerenciamento de inventário e plataformas de engajamento do cliente. Sua capacidade de lidar com grandes volumes de dados em tempo real a torna indispensável para negócios modernos orientados a dados.
Confluent e Snowflake servem a propósitos distintos no cenário de gerenciamento de dados, tornando improvável que um substitua completamente o outro. Confluent se especializa em streaming de dados em tempo real e arquitetura orientada a eventos, permitindo que as organizações processem e analisem dados à medida que chegam.
Enquanto isso, Snowflake foca em armazenamento de dados baseado em nuvem, fornecendo armazenamento escalável e consulta otimizada para dados estruturados. Embora Confluent possa complementar Snowflake alimentando fluxos de dados em tempo real para Snowflake para análise adicional, não pode substituir completamente o papel do Snowflake no armazenamento de dados.
Determinar se o Confluent é mais barato que o Snowflake depende de vários fatores, como uso, escala e requisitos específicos. Modelo de precificação do Confluent geralmente gira em torno do uso e das funcionalidades, com custos potencialmente aumentando à medida que os volumes de dados e as necessidades de processamento crescem.
O Snowflake, por outro lado, opera em uma estrutura de preços pay-as-you-go, incluindo custos para armazenamento, computação e funcionalidades adicionais, como compartilhamento de dados. Enquanto o Confluent pode oferecer vantagens de custo para organizações que se concentram principalmente em streaming de dados em tempo real e processamento de eventos, o modelo de precificação do Snowflake pode ser mais favorável para aqueles que priorizam armazenamento de dados e análises.
Enquanto a Confluent oferece uma plataforma robusta para streaming de dados em tempo real e arquitetura orientada a eventos, é importante considerar opções de software alternativas para garantir que você encontre a melhor opção para suas necessidades específicas.
Várias alternativas notáveis à Confluent no espaço de streaming de dados e processamento de eventos incluem Apache Kafka (a fundação de código aberto da Confluent), Snowflake, Amazon Web Services (AWS), Google Cloud Pub/Sub e Microsoft Azure Event Hubs.
Embora a Confluent possa oferecer soluções abrangentes e facilidade de integração com ecossistemas Kafka existentes, explorar essas alternativas pode fornecer insights valiosos e ajudá-lo a tomar uma decisão informada alinhada com os objetivos de gerenciamento de dados de sua organização.
Beneficie-se de 12 meses grátis em Confluent e economize $20.000 com Secret.
Snowflake e Confluent desempenham papéis distintos, mas complementares, no panorama de gerenciamento de dados. Snowflake se destaca como uma plataforma de armazenamento de dados em nuvem, fornecendo armazenamento escalável e consultas otimizadas para dados estruturados.
Enquanto isso, Confluent se especializa em streaming de dados em tempo real e arquitetura orientada a eventos, permitindo que as organizações processem e analisem dados à medida que chegam. Enquanto o Snowflake oferece análises poderosas e capacidades de consulta estruturada, o Confluent foca em insights em tempo real e processamento de eventos.
Comparar Snowflake com Confluent envolve entender suas distintas forças em lidar com necessidades de dados. O desempenho superior do Snowflake em armazenamento de dados o torna a opção preferida para organizações que priorizam consultas e gerenciamento de dados eficientes. Sua arquitetura simplifica operações complexas de dados e se escala dinamicamente para acomodar demandas flutuantes, tornando-o ideal para aqueles que dependem fortemente de SQL e análises de dados estruturados.
Em contraste, enquanto Confluent se destaca no streaming de dados em tempo real, a plataforma robusta e amigável do Snowflake oferece uma funcionalidade mais ampla para análise de dados históricos e manipulação extensa de dados. Assim, para empresas focadas em análise de dados aprofundada e escalabilidade, o Snowflake muitas vezes se destaca como a melhor escolha.
Snowflake é melhor utilizado para armazenamento de dados na nuvem, oferecendo armazenamento escalável e consultas otimizadas para dados estruturados. As organizações aproveitam o Snowflake para centralizar e analisar grandes quantidades de dados de forma eficiente, tornando-o ideal para análise de dados, inteligência de negócios e relatórios. Sua arquitetura, projetada para alta concorrência e desempenho, permite que múltiplos usuários executem consultas complexas simultaneamente sem comprometer a velocidade.
A facilidade de uso do Snowflake, a escalabilidade automática e o modelo de preços pay-as-you-go o tornam atraente para empresas que buscam uma solução flexível e econômica para gerenciar e analisar grandes conjuntos de dados na nuvem. É particularmente benéfico para organizações que estão fazendo a transição de armazéns de dados tradicionais locais para soluções modernas baseadas na nuvem.
Enquanto o Snowflake se destaca em armazenamento de dados em nuvem e consultas otimizadas para dados estruturados, não foi projetado para substituir as capacidades especializadas da Confluent em streaming de dados em tempo real e arquitetura orientada a eventos. O Snowflake foca em análises e processamento de dados estruturados, enquanto a Confluent é adaptada para processar e analisar dados à medida que chegam em tempo real.
Enquanto o Snowflake pode complementar a Confluent ao ingerir e analisar dados históricos, não pode substituir completamente o papel da Confluent no processamento de eventos em tempo real. A decisão de usar o Snowflake ou a Confluent, ou ambos, depende das necessidades específicas de gerenciamento de dados da organização, com cada plataforma oferecendo vantagens distintas em seus respectivos domínios.
Determinar se Snowflake é mais barato que Confluent depende de vários fatores, como uso, escala e requisitos específicos. Snowflake opera em uma estrutura de preços pay-as-you-go, incluindo custos de armazenamento, computação e recursos adicionais como compartilhamento de dados. Em contraste, o modelo de preços da Confluent geralmente gira em torno do uso e dos recursos, podendo aumentar os custos à medida que os volumes de dados e as necessidades de processamento aumentam.
Enquanto a estrutura de preços do Snowflake pode oferecer vantagens de custo para organizações focadas principalmente em data warehousing e consultas estruturadas, o preço da Confluent pode ser mais favorável para aqueles que priorizam streaming de dados em tempo real e processamento de eventos.
Enquanto o Snowflake oferece uma poderosa solução de armazenamento de dados baseada em nuvem, é prudente explorar opções de software alternativas para garantir que você encontre a melhor opção para suas necessidades específicas.
Várias alternativas notáveis ao Snowflake no espaço de armazenamento de dados e análises incluem Confluent, MongoDB, Amazon Redshift, Google BigQuery, Microsoft Azure Synapse Analytics e Snowpark.
Embora o Snowflake possa oferecer recursos robustos e facilidade de uso, explorar essas alternativas pode fornecer insights valiosos e ajudá-lo a tomar uma decisão informada alinhada com seus objetivos de gerenciamento de dados.
Embora tanto o Confluent quanto o Snowflake ofereçam plataformas robustas de gerenciamento e análise de dados, o fator de facilidade de uso varia significativamente entre os dois.
O Confluent, aproveitando o Apache Kafka, oferece uma poderosa plataforma de streaming de dados. No entanto, dominar as complexidades do Kafka pode representar desafios, particularmente para novatos ou aqueles que não possuem expertise técnica. Por exemplo, configurar clusters Kafka e entender sua arquitetura de sistema distribuído pode ser tarefas desafiadoras.
Em contraste, o Snowflake se destaca por sua interface intuitiva de data warehouse baseada em nuvem. Com um layout limpo e consultas baseadas em SQL, os usuários podem rapidamente navegar e manipular dados sem treinamento extensivo. Por exemplo, fazer upload e consultar dados no Snowflake se assemelha a bancos de dados SQL tradicionais, simplificando a curva de aprendizado.
Confluent se destaca por suas robustas capacidades de integração, especialmente com seu amplo suporte a sistemas de terceiros através de mais de 120 conectores pré-construídos, tornando-o altamente adaptável a diversos ecossistemas de dados. Através do Kafka Connect, Confluent aprimora o movimento de dados em tempo real com conectores para uma variedade de sistemas em diferentes categorias, como bancos de dados, serviços em nuvem e plataformas de análise de dados. Por exemplo, conectores para Salesforce e MongoDB permitem a importação e exportação de dados de forma contínua, apoiando arquiteturas orientadas a eventos de maneira eficaz. Além disso, a API flexível da Confluent suporta projetos de integração personalizados, como a integração com Apache Flink para análises em tempo real aprimoradas, atendendo assim demandas operacionais únicas.
Em contraste, Snowflake foca em ser uma solução abrangente de armazenamento de dados com fortes recursos de integração para ferramentas de análise e gerenciamento de dados. Ele suporta uma variedade de aplicações de BI, ETL e ciência de dados através de seus conectores e APIs avançados. Por exemplo, sua integração com Tableau aprimora as capacidades dos usuários em visualização interativa de dados, enquanto integrações com ferramentas ETL como Informatica otimizam os processos de transformação de dados. Snowflake também se destaca no compartilhamento e replicação de dados entre diferentes regiões, garantindo alta disponibilidade e consistência, o que é crucial para operações globais.
Snowflake apresenta uma proposta atraente para startups que buscam otimizar suas finanças. Oferecendo créditos gratuitos, as startups podem rapidamente construir e escalar aplicações e produtos orientados a dados sem incorrer em custos imediatos, um benefício para aqueles que operam com um orçamento restrito. Por exemplo, as startups podem aproveitar os créditos do Snowflake para explorar análise de dados e geração de insights, estabelecendo as bases para o crescimento e inovação futuros.
Em contraste, enquanto a Confluent possui uma plataforma robusta para streaming de dados em tempo real, ela carece de incentivos financeiros ou créditos explícitos, potencialmente desmotivando startups que buscam soluções econômicas. Sem incentivos financeiros, as startups podem achar desafiador justificar o investimento inicial na plataforma da Confluent, dificultando os esforços de otimização financeira.
O recurso Schema Registry da Confluent revoluciona a arquitetura de dados ao permitir que as empresas definam e gerenciem esquemas para seus dados de forma centralizada. Isso garante consistência e facilita atualizações contínuas em múltiplos sistemas e aplicações, melhorando a confiabilidade e interoperabilidade dos dados. Por exemplo, as empresas podem usar o Schema Registry para impor regras de validação de dados e garantir compatibilidade entre diferentes fontes de dados e consumidores.
Em contraste, o Snowflake não possui um recurso comparável para gerenciamento centralizado de esquemas, potencialmente complicando as tarefas de arquitetura de dados. Sem as capacidades do Schema Registry, as empresas podem enfrentar desafios na manutenção da consistência dos dados e na gestão eficaz da evolução dos esquemas.
Enquanto tanto o Confluent quanto o Snowflake oferecem recursos robustos de gerenciamento de dados, o Snowflake se destaca com suas capacidades avançadas de IA. Essas funcionalidades permitem que as empresas otimizem fluxos de trabalho, classifiquem dados automaticamente e agilizem a descoberta de insights valiosos. Por exemplo, o perfilamento de dados impulsionado por IA do Snowflake pode identificar automaticamente padrões e anomalias nos dados, facilitando a preparação e análise eficientes dos dados.
Em contraste, o Confluent carece de capacidades de IA comparáveis, limitando potencialmente sua capacidade de automatizar tarefas de processamento de dados e extrair insights acionáveis de grandes conjuntos de dados. Sem funcionalidades avançadas de IA, as empresas podem achar desafiador desbloquear todo o potencial de seus dados, colocando assim o Snowflake à frente na capacitação da tomada de decisões orientadas por dados.
Confluent possui uma vantagem distinta no desenvolvimento de aplicações em tempo real com seu recurso KSQL, um mecanismo de streaming semelhante ao SQL. Esta ferramenta inovadora capacita as empresas a trabalharem de forma contínua com dados em streaming, realizando transformações e gerando alertas ou relatórios em tempo real sem a necessidade de codificação extensa. Por exemplo, as empresas podem aproveitar o KSQL para detectar padrões em fluxos de dados em tempo real e acionar ações automatizadas de acordo.
Em contraste, a Snowflake atualmente não possui um recurso comparável para construir aplicações em tempo real, limitando potencialmente sua utilidade em ambientes dinâmicos e orientados a eventos. Sem as capacidades do KSQL, os usuários da Snowflake podem enfrentar desafios ao processar e responder a dados em streaming com a mesma agilidade e eficiência que os usuários da Confluent.
Snowflake se destaca com recursos de segurança de ponta, como criptografia do lado do cliente e autenticação multifator, garantindo a segurança e integridade dos seus dados. Por exemplo, a criptografia do lado do cliente permite que os usuários criptografem dados antes mesmo de chegarem ao servidor Snowflake, garantindo proteção de ponta a ponta contra acesso não autorizado. Além disso, a arquitetura escalável do Snowflake acomoda facilmente o crescimento e expansão organizacional, garantindo escalabilidade sem comprometer o desempenho ou a segurança.
Em contraste, enquanto o Confluent oferece uma ferramenta robusta de Replicador para replicação de dados confiável e segura, ele carece de detalhes explícitos sobre suas capacidades ou recursos de armazenamento de dados. Isso deixa incertezas quanto à sua adequação para necessidades de armazenamento de dados seguras e escaláveis. Consequentemente, o Snowflake surge como a escolha preferida para organizações que priorizam soluções de armazenamento de dados seguras e escaláveis.
Fique conectado e receba diretamente todas as nossas últimas ofertas na sua caixa de entrada, assim como os 110.000+ usuários com nosso boletim mensal (+ Ganhe 10% de desconto na assinatura premium!)
Secret já ajudou dezenas de milhares de startups a economizar milhões de euros nos melhores SaaS como Confluent, Snowflake e muitos outros. Junte-se ao Secret agora para comprar seus SaaS de maneira mais inteligente.